dc:description.abstractPurpose: Evaluate and compare obtained mydriasis with phenylephrine 10% associated with tropicamide 1%, in type 2 diabetics and non-diabetic patients. Methods: A total of 60 patients (120 eyes) scheduled for fundoscopy were dilated with phenylephrine 10% and tropicamide 1% (group 0, n=30 type 2 diabetic patients, 60 eyes and group 1, n=30 non-diabetic patients, 60 eyes). Only one drop per eye of each drug was administered. In both groups, pupil diameter was measured after 40 minutes of eyedrops instillation. Results: Mean age for the diabetic group was 62.27 years (SD = 8.61 years) and for the non-diabetic group was 56.57 years (SD = 17.28 years). There was no significant difference between both groups. (p = 0.18). Considering right eyes, mean pupil diameter was 8.47 mm in the diabetic group (SD = 0.86 mm) and 8.77 mm (SD = 0.86 mm) in the non-diabetic group. There was no significant difference between both groups (p = 0.15). Considering left eyes, mean pupil diameter was 8.53 mm in the diabetic group (SD = 0.94 mm) and 8.77 mm (SD = 0.86 mm) in the non-diabetic group. There was no significant difference between the two groups (p = 0.32). Conclusion: When the combination of phenylephrine 10% and tropicamide 1% is used, type 2 diabetic patients can achieve mydriasis as satisfactory as non-diabetic patients, allowing adequate fundus examination and/or retinopathy treatment.
